§ 26-27-306 — Oath of members

Text
(a)Each member of a county equalization board, before entering upon the discharge of his or her duties, shall take the oath of office prescribed in Arkansas Constitution, Article 19, § 20, and further, that he or she will fearlessly, impartially, and faithfully equalize the assessed value of all property assessed and subject to taxation.
(b)The oath shall be subscribed and sworn to by each member of the county equalization board before the county clerk, and the county clerk shall make it a matter of record in his or her office.

Legislative History
Acts 1929, No. 172, § 25; Pope's Dig., § 13643; A.S.A. 1947, § 84-705.
